JOB DESCRIPTION

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Approve, release, and monitor status of production and purchase requisitions.
  • Develop and provide input to manufacturing build plan
  • Develop priorities and communicate support functions while taking an active role in problem resolution as required.
  • Coordinate with all shop departments to ensure proper inventory levels - maintain knowledge of plant operations and equipment design in order to plan properly.
  • Review and release work orders per the system demand, manage the system recommended messages, as well as maintain work order dates that adhere to the metrics for the organization.
  • Periodically review non-conformances and engineering changes to rework any work orders as required.
  • Regularly update work order due dates based on fluctuations in capacity and delivery schedules from suppliers.
  • Keep Planning Manager aware of applicable changes that would affect the lead time of the part so that the system can be kept up to date.
  • Regularly monitor and update safety stock levels in the system when necessary.
  • Comply with all NOV Company and HSE policies and procedures.
  • Perform all other duties as assigned.
